This shows gpio_post_bind being called, then the four gpio-hogs found and set to probe after bind, but the gpio_hog_probe function is never actually called. Presumably this is the problem - if they're not probed then they'll never take effect?
I enabled CONFIG_DM_WARN and CONFIG_DM_DEBUG, which confirm that nothing ever seems to be probing the gpio-hog children, but there aren't obviously any errors or warnings related to them either. Nothing relevant happens after gpio_post_bind is called.
Following up to myself here, I enabled CONFIG_CMD_DM which seems to confirm they aren't getting probed:

I noted that the parent gpio-controller wasn't getting probed either, so tried this:
--- a/u-boot/drivers/pinctrl/mediatek/pinctrl-mt7981.c +++ b/u-boot/drivers/pinctrl/mediatek/pinctrl-mt7981.c @@ -1038,6 +1038,12 @@ static int mtk_pinctrl_mt7981_probe(struct udevice *dev) return mtk_pinctrl_common_probe(dev, &mt7981_data); }
+static int mtk_pinctrl_mt7981_bind(struct udevice *dev) +{ + dev_or_flags(dev, DM_FLAG_PROBE_AFTER_BIND); + return 0; +} + static const struct udevice_id mt7981_pctrl_match[] = { {.compatible = "mediatek,mt7981-pinctrl"}, { /* sentinel */ } @@ -1048,6 +1054,7 @@ U_BOOT_DRIVER(mt7981_pinctrl) = { .id = UCLASS_PINCTRL, .of_match = mt7981_pctrl_match, .ops = &mtk_pinctrl_ops, + .bind = mtk_pinctrl_mt7981_bind, .probe = mtk_pinctrl_mt7981_probe, .priv_auto = sizeof(struct mtk_pinctrl_priv), };
This does indeed fix the problem: the hogs get probed and the gpios show as active outputs on gpio status -a on boot.
But presumably this is all supposed to work without patching that?
